7. Tyson Wasn't Ready to Fight Buster Douglas
4 of 10In 1990, Mike Tyson lost to Buster Douglas, who was a 42-to-1 underdog. To this day, it is still considered one of the biggest upsets of all-time in boxing. Tyson admitted the sins he committed just before this fight, according to Rick Reilly of ESPN.
"In Tokyo, he "smoked pot," "didn't take training too seriously" and went through "too many of them Japanese prostitutes"?
"
Tyson also admits that on the day of his fight vs. Andrew Golota, he took marijuana just before going out on the ring.

5. Tyson Confirms He Is Broke and Always Will Be
6 of 10A few decades ago, he was young, popular and rich. Tyson's present is all but similar to his past. The Iron doesn't have a single penny and he admits that he knows he will never be rich again. According to Dylan Stableford of Yahoo!:
""I don't think I'm ever not [going to be broke]," Tyson told Yahoo News. "I owe too much money to the IRS. I'm never going to be able to attain a great fortune of wealth.
"
As Tyson already said in the past, in March 1996 (via Boxing Monthly):
"No one gives a f**k about me. No one cares if my children starve, if they're on welfare. I have to support my children. I need more money.

1. Tyson Will Never Admit the Rape Crime
10 of 10Mike Tyson has done several bad things in his life and he confessed most of them. Still, he insists that he never committed the crime sending him to jail for three years. The Iron was found guilty of rape.
He's basically getting naked in front of the entire world by revealing the details of the darkest moments of his life. Most of us wouldn't be able to tell this truth to our friends. Still, Tyson tells it to millions of people.
Why would he keep denying this crime? Was he really innocent? I guess he will bring this secret to his grave! From the Associated Press:
"“There’s a lot of things I could have gone to jail for and I deserved to go to jail for,” he said. “But this wasn’t one of them. I didn’t do it and I will never admit doing it.”
